Amazon Takes Retail Approach to Push Flagging Fire Phone
Posted in: Uncategorized“You’ve got an iPhone,” said Brian Jausurawong. “You’re probably due for an upgrade,” gesturing to a display shelf stacked with Amazon Fire smartphones.
As it turns out, the interlocutor with Mr. Jausurawong, an Amazon sales representative, works for the tech giant, too (she was shooting a promo video). But Amazon did host actual customers in its ‘pop-up’ store at the ground floor of a downtown San Francisco mall. It’s the second year the e-commerce giant has had a brick-and-mortar holiday presence, but the first one involving its maiden smartphone.
On Thursday afternoon, a day after the store opened, around two dozen passersby strolled through to check Amazon tablets, e-readers, TV set-boxes and phones. Some were skeptical of its newest gizmo.
